Welcome to this exciting JavaScript coding challenge where we tackle the problem of maximizing the running time of multiple computers using a set of batteries. We’ll be utilizing the powerful binary search algorithm to solve this problem in a unique and efficient way.

In this problem, we’re given n computers and a number of batteries, each capable of running a computer for a certain number of minutes. Our goal is to make all n computers run simultaneously for as long as possible. The twist? We can swap batteries between computers any number of times and it takes no time. However, batteries can’t be recharged. Sounds challenging, right?
